Sri Siddhartha Medical College (SSMC), Tumkur
Sri Siddhartha Medical College (SSMC) is a medical institution located in Tumkur,
Karnataka, India. It is a constituent college of Sri Siddhartha Academy of
Higher Education (SSAHE), a deemed-to-be-university.
Key information
- Location: Tumkur, Karnataka, India.
- Affiliation: Constituent College of Sri Siddhartha
Academy of Higher Education (SSAHE).
- Accreditation: Approved by the Medical Council of
India (MCI) and accredited by NAAC with a "Grade A".
- Ranking: Ranked 15th in the "Medical"
category by Outlook in 2024.
Courses offered
- Undergraduate: MBBS.
- Postgraduate: MD/MS in various specialties.
Admission requirements
- MBBS:
- 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English, with a minimum
of 50% aggregate marks in PCB for the General category and 40% for
reserved categories.
- Must qualify for the NEET-UG examination.
- Must participate in Karnataka NEET counselling/MCC
Counselling.
Facilities
- Hospital: The SSMC Hospital is a 970+ bedded facility
with separate buildings for OPD and casualty, housing various departments
such as Medicine, Surgery, OBG, Ophthalmology, Orthopedics, Pediatrics, ENT,
Dermatology, and Radiology.
- Operation Theatres: Equipped with 12 major operation
theaters and minor operation theaters.
- Other Facilities: The hospital building also contains
a post office, bank, canteen, hospital mess, fruit stall, and a phone booth.
- Library: The college has a well-equipped library with
3800 books, 61 current journals, and a digital section for e-journals.
- Dental College: A separate Dental College, located 100
meters from SSMC, with qualified faculty and state-of-the-art technology at
the "Siddhartha Smile" center.
